WebJun 24, 2024 · Leslie’s Crested Bird’s Nest Fern care guide. Birds Nest ferns are easy care plants once you get them in the right spot with the right watering schedule. Bird’s Nest Fern watering. Bird’s nest ferns like to stay moist. Water when the top of the soil feels dry. If the soil looks compact, it is much too dry and needs a good soaking. WebJan 12, 2024 · Your bird's nest fern will grow best in consistently moist soil. WebJun 21, 2024 · Temperature & Humidity. Indoor temperature for this fern should be between 68-80 degrees. Make sure the temperature in your home doesn’t get below 60 F. WebSep 18, 2024 · The Hurricane Bird’s Nest Fern, scientifically known as Asplenium Nidus, is a highly sought-after houseplant that hails from tropical regions. Its distinct circular frond pattern, reminiscent of a bird’s nest, is a sight to behold. This fern is also known by other monikers such as the Crow’s Nest Fern or the Bird’s Nest Fern.

WebNov 28, 2024 · Ferns with thick leaves, such as the bird's nest fern (Asplenium nidus), tolerate dryer air than lacy-leaved ferns. They grow in a tight, nest-like clump with a lingulate leaf rosette. … spectrum health lakeland job openingsWebDec 14, 2024 · The Best Light Exposure for Bird’s Nest Ferns Grown Indoors. When growing bird’s nest ferns indoors, try to mimic their natural habitat — the understory of the rain forest canopy — as closely as possible. In the wild, the ferns thrive in dappled light and partial shade. Indoors, choose sites with medium indirect light or low light ... spectrum health lakeland niles lab
